How much do safe ride j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for safe ride in San Antonio, TX is $12.17,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$10.19 and $13.89 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Safe Ride?

A Safe Ride job typically involves providing transportation services to ensure passengers get home safely, often during late-night hours or in situations where driving may be unsafe. Responsibilities may include driving a designated vehicle, assisting passengers, and ensuring a secure and comfortable ride. These jobs are often offered by universities, transportation services, or ride programs aimed at reducing impaired driving.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Safe Ride position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Safe Ride driver, you need a valid driver's license with a clean driving record, strong knowledge of road safety, and experience in customer service. Certification in defensive driving and proficiency with GPS navigation systems and ride scheduling apps are commonly required. Excellent interpersonal skills, patience, and the ability to remain calm under pressure help build trust with passengers and handle unexpected situations. These skills ensure passenger safety, reliability, and a positive experience in this essential transportation service.

What does a typical shift look like for a Safe Ride driver?

A typical shift for a Safe Ride driver involves coordinating with dispatchers or ride management software to pick up and safely transport passengers, often during evenings, weekends, or special events when demand is higher. You'll regularly interact with passengers from diverse backgrounds, ensuring they reach their destinations safely and comfortably. Safe Ride drivers may also assist individuals with special needs, enforce safety protocols, and maintain vehicle cleanliness. Teamwork with other drivers and communication with support staff are important components of the role, creating a collaborative and supportive work environment. This structure makes each shift dynamic while upholding the core mission of providing safe and reliable transportation.

Responsibilities
As a Ride Operator at Six Flags Fiesta Texas, you are the first line of excitement and safety. You'll create unforgettable guest experiences by operating thrilling attractions, enforcing safety procedures, and keeping the fun flowing smoothly. From energizing guests before launch to responding calmly and confidently in high-pressure moments, you'll play a critical role in delivering safe, heart-pounding memories.
You'll also:
  • Keep ride areas clean and guest-ready
  • Maintain professionalism in every interaction
  • Respond swiftly and responsibly to any emergency
  • If you love fast-paced environments, live entertainment vibes, and being part of something legendary-this is your ride.

HOW YOU WILL DO IT:
  • Create exciting, high-energy experiences for guests and teammates
  • Put safety first-always-while delivering nonstop fun
  • Perform daily equipment checks before rides open
  • Confidently operate rides using controls, signals, and communication
  • Assist guests with boarding, unloading, and safety instructions
  • Be ready to stop a ride instantly in critical situations
  • Rotate between various attractions-from family favorites to extreme thrill rides
  • Work in environments that may include weather exposure, heights, and loud machinery
  • Keep ride areas clean, safe, and welcoming (including queues, surfaces, and trash areas)
  • Accurately complete required paperwork and ride documentation

Qualifications
    • Must be at least 16 years old
    • Strong awareness of safety and ability to respond to emergencies
    • Availability for flexible schedules, including weekends, nights, and holidays
    • Thrive in a fast-paced, guest-focused environment
    • Comfortable working independently and as part of a team
    • Friendly, outgoing, and professional with guests
    • Ability to stand, walk, bend, reach, and move for extended periods
    • Capable of reading and following ride operating procedures
    • Successfully pass ride certification tests with 100% accuracy
